Output db59199363ef4b567d8df7c45a652d0dec258980358bac94375d589e06e95002:35

value
3390446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f862747bf391e8cd1f6600052d254a6c59d90abc OP_EQUAL
address
3QLMSthUuNUhXTvB55Lr8fP1o7g9w9Z2Bp
transaction
db59199363ef4b567d8df7c45a652d0dec258980358bac94375d589e06e95002
spent
true